George had the quality most cherished by El Morya—constancy. Once he found the Great White Brotherhood in 1961, he attended every conference thereafter and accompanied the messengers on their trips to India, the Middle East, and South America. He would rise every morning between two and three o’clock, greet the masters, and decree until six, when he would go about his duties at the Cherokee Mobile Home Park in Anaheim, which he ran with his wife, Beth. The park was a model of beauty and efficiency in which they both took pride; and in later years, George especially enjoyed tending the garden which provided his famous tomatoes and a wide assortment of vegetables to all his neighbors and friends.
